Communication with your Adelaide Hills architect

Communication between the residential client and their architect is the key to the successful completion of a project. The architect must understand the requirements of the client, as well as the client’s site, national and local planning and building codes as they relate to the project, and how the budget is going to work. Get the best Commercial Building design in the Adelaide Hills.

Commercial buildings are generally of two types: single-storey and multi-storey. Whether your building is one or the other depends upon your site area. A large site area will probably mean that a single-storey building is most economic; a smaller site may indicate multi-storey design. Multi-storey commercial buildings in the Adelaide Hills

You may opt to go multi-storey with your new commercial building if the area of your site is restricted. Two storey buildings are common in the Adelaide Hills; commercial building owners and tenants often locate staff amenities and offices upstairs, with the ground floors occupied by retail or industrial activities.
